Certain CPU-intensive activities like compression seem like trivial things and
perform very well when you are on a recent CPU architecture. If you go back a
few CPU generations or you have a very low clock speed, these activities can
become performance bottlenecks. This is common on affordable (low-end)
hardware from only a few years ago.

> There have been performance complaints on the mailing list about the default
> compressed stored fields in the 4.1 index format. There should be an option
> to turn the compression off.
